I've heard a lot of good things about the TS-850, and got to use one at
Field Day the last few years. So I'm thinking about buying one, but want to avoid any "duds" if they are identifiable. I've noticed a few ads telling about selling the 850 for parts because they bought one used "as is" that didn't really work as advertised. There have been references to serial numbers, like the 60K mark due to a modification capability, but I'm not too concerned about that particular mod. Your thoughts? |

There have been references to serial numbers, like the 60K mark due to a modification capability, but I'm not too concerned about that particular mod. Your thoughts? One of Kenwood's great rigs IMHO. Had one for many years with no troubles. For RTTYor contesting, it would run keydown for long periods -- big heavy duty heatsink. CW filters are quite good The dynamic range was superb, better than my latest TS-870S. RE Duds -- When I buy used gear, I ask the seller for a guarantee that the rig is fully operational in all modes and bands. Then I test it with my HP equipment for power output, sensitivity, etc. You can read about Common Problems with the 850 and Possible Cures AT URL: http://n6tr.jzap.com/850repair.html -- CL -- I doubt, therefore I might be ! |
